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
872 0639089 03210682 6727809914 27955
01 61571
01 61571
627273 29 08190190847
All about undefined
Interested in learning more?
01 61571
627273 29 08190190847
See more
4521797163 9891 9436669
78826 04114336416 3671217
See more
31339782 1443041 189443301
14492998593 9174 61006 31 15
See more